Nguyen Thuy Linh is the runner-up at the German Open badminton tournament for the second consecutive time.

How much money did Thuy Linh receive?

No. 1 seed Yeo Jia Min (Singapore, ranked 13th in the world) showed confidence when competing again with No. 1 Vietnamese player Nguyen Thuy Linh (ranked 29th in the world) in the final of the German Open badminton tournament. Because in the last 3 encounters, No. 1 Singapore player defeated Nguyen Thuy Linh.

Nguyen Thuy Linh entered the finals of the German Open badminton tournament for the second consecutive time but could not be crowned.

In game 1, Yeo Jia Min, with extremely strong and accurate smashes, quickly created a gap of up to 7 points (9/2) against Nguyen Thuy Linh. The Dong Nai player persistently followed and was effective in short shots near the net, thereby narrowing the gap to only 2 points (11/13). At the crucial moment of this game, Yeo Jia Min took advantage of the opportunity better and rose to win 21/16.

Nguyen Thuy Linh won the women's singles runner-up at the 2025 German Open badminton tournament

Playing with determination in the second set, Nguyen Thuy Linh continued to let the Singaporean player create a gap of 5 points (6/11), including 2 unfortunate misses. Returning after the break, Nguyen Thuy Linh exerted her strength, narrowing the gap to 2 points (15/17). However, that was all the Vietnamese badminton beauty could do because then the player Yeo Jia Min came back strongly, winning 21/17 and closing the final victory 2-0, thereby becoming the champion.

The title of runner-up in the women's singles at the 2025 German Open Badminton Tournament brought Nguyen Thuy Linh a prize of 9,120 USD (about 230 million VND) and 5,950 bonus points on the Badminton World Federation (BWF) rankings. This is the second consecutive year that Nguyen Thuy Linh has finished second at the German Open Badminton Tournament, an impressive achievement in the career of this beautiful tennis player.
